Hendrickson Top-10 in Hinzenbach

HINZENBACH, Austria (Jan. 31, 2015) - Sarah Hendrickson (Park City, UT) set aside a tough competition in Oberstdorf, Germany last weekend, soaring back into the top-10 in a FIS Ski Jumping World Cup at Hinzenbach. Austria’s Daniela Iraschko-Stoltz won again.
Hendrickson flew 88.5 meters in the first round to stand third, before dropping back on the second jump.
“Today was a really good day for me,” said Hendrickson. “I have changed some things in my technique this past week and it's made a world of a difference. I am more confident and stable with everything. Today was a really fair competition and I had a great time competing.”
